After further investigation and chat with kind OCI Support team, it became apparent that this issue is related to a change of endpoint format and may affect multiple regions including me-riyadh-1. The following is from comments in this repository:
# New Endpoint format: <region>.<service>.<oci/ocp/ocs>.<oraclecloud/oracleiaas>.com # Old Endpoint format: <Service Identifier>.<Region ID>.oraclecloud.com OR <Service Identifier>.<AD#>.<Region ID>.<oraclecloud/oracleiaas>.com # Above info is from below confluence links:
# Old endpoint naming convention: https://confluence.oci.oraclecorp.com/display/PM/OCI+-+Service+Endpoints # New endpoint naming convention: https://confluence.oci.oraclecorp.com/display/~sumidey/Service+Endpoint+Update
Please, accept this PR which will allow flexibility for overwriting the Cryptographic Endpoint to 'oraclecloud.com' or 'oci.oraclecloud.com' or 'oracleiaas.com' etc. as below:
oci artifacts container image-signature sign-upload .... --base-domain-overwrite oci.oraclecloud.com
